Rev 1:9 I John, who also am your brother, and companion in tribulation, and in the kingdom and patience of Jesus Christ, was in the isle that is called Patmos, for the word of God, and for the testimony of Jesus Christ. 10 I was in the Spirit on the Lord's day, and heard behind me a great voice, as of a trumpet, 11 Saying, I am Alpha and Omega, the first and the last: and, What thou seest, write in a book, and send it unto the seven churches which are in Asia; unto Ephesus, and unto Smyrna, and unto Pergamos, and unto Thyatira, and unto Sardis, and unto Philadelphia, and unto Laodicea.

John, our brother, companion in tribulation, in the kingdom and in the patience of the Lord, found himself:

*Isolated
*Dedicated to the Word of God
*Standing on his testimony
*In the Spirit
*Faithful to the Lord's day
*Hearing the voice of the Lord

Today is the Lord's day. I pray that each of us will isolate ourselves from the world in our island of fellowship, the church. I would hope that we would all be dedicated to the Word, stand true to the stuff, be filled with the Spirit and pay heed to the voice of the Lord.
